    Light source with variable wavelength based on acousto-optical deflector

    Get PDF
    The proposed work analyzes the design features of the acousto-optical de?ector and ?lter on paratelurite. It is shown that under certain conditions the acousto-optical de?ector can be used as an acousto-optical ?lter (as an element that performs spectral ?ltering of the incident light beam). The fundamental possibility of creating  a monochromatic light source  with a variable wavelength and a spectrum width of about 5 nm using an acousto-optical de?ector as an element that adjusts the original wavelength is shown experimentally. As a broadband  light source  in this system, a semiconductor laser operating in subthreshold mode was used. The dependence of the output wavelength on the acoustic frequency is obtained. The comparison of experimental data with the calculated ones is given, it is shown that they have small di?erences. Pages of the article in the issue: 116 - 119 Language of the article: Ukrainia

    About audience overlaps in the social media

    Get PDF
    In this paper we provided the definition of the Audience overlap network, as well as proposed a simple algorithm to compute overlap between two users on social media based on public data about their followers. There was proposed an alternative approach for computing overlaps based only on public data about users. This approach allows to include content overlap and activity patterns signals to be incorporated into more general statistical models featuring other covariates such as influencers’ direct engagement in shared conversations; relative influencer sizes and histories and links to similar third-party content to recover otherwise censored network structures and properties. For validate results there was designed a calibration process which utilizes Evolution Strategies algorithm to find a set of conditions which will make Audience overlap network built using similarity measures structurally equivalent to the Audience overlap network build on full information about followers.     Research of e-sports development world tendencies on the base of Data Mining methods

    Get PDF
    The article analyzes the current state and trends of e-sports in the world by studying the time series of the number of requests from Internet users, obtained through the use of Google Trends. The positive and negative consequences of e-sports development in the world have been identified. The forecasting of world tendencies of e-sports by means of methods of data mining is carried out. Using the application of multivariate adaptive regression splines (MARSplines), a model of the relationship between the predictor - a time indicator and the dependent variable - the time series of the number of requests of Internet users, which are non-monotonic in nature and provide the possibility of regression switching points. The adequacy of the constructed model is proved by means of regression statistics and histogram of correspondence of residuals to the normal distribution law. The expediency of using the method of multivariate adaptive regression splines (MARSplines) before other statistical methods is substantiated.     Study of nanosized gold films by scanning tunneling microscopy

    Get PDF
    It was shown that despite the difference in the morphology of thin gold films obtained by different methods and on different substrates, the films mainly consist of spherical nanoparticles. The linear dimensions of individual surface objects were determined using the example of a gold film on mica. Analysis of the surface morphology showed that its structural formations are evenly distributed and have sizes from 250 nm to 500 nm. Upon receipt of gold nanofilms by magnetron sputtering on a glass substrate, the size of individual gold nanoparticles ranges from 20 nm to 80 nm. When ion spraying on a substrate of polished monocrystalline silicon, the size of individual gold nanoparticles ranges from 2 nm to 10 nm. The union of individual nanoparticles into large elongated nanoobjects up to 20-40 nm in size is observed. Thus, having the opportunity to compare data on the mode of vacuum deposition (substrate temperature, beam density, deposition time, etc.), as well as surface relief, you can develop technologies for obtaining a surface with a given set of properties, as well as develop new methods of gold deposition on different surfaces. The obtained results are very important for application in biology and medicine. They make it possible to create different types of sensors and diagnostic tests.     Damped steady-state resonant sloshing in a container of circular cross-section for arbitrary periodic nonparametric forcing

    Get PDF
    Nonlinear modal Narimanov-Moiseev—type equations are investigated to study resonant sloshing in a vertical cylindrical tank. The tank moves periodically in the space with the forcing frequency close to the lowest natural sloshing frequency. We show that the considered sloshing problem can to within the higher-order asymptotic terms be reduced to the case of orbital tank motions in the horizontal plane. Analytical solutions of the secular system which couples the dominant amplitudes of the steady-state sloshing are analytically solved. Effect of viscous damping is accounted. The results are compared with experimental measurements conducted by diverse authors for longitudinal and circular orbital tank excitations. A parametric analysis of the amplitude curves is done to clarify how the steady-state wave regimes and their stability change versus the forcing frequency and the semi-axes ratio of the elliptic orbit. The main result consists of confirming the experimental disappearance of the counter-directed swirling wave mode (relative to the elliptic orbit direction) when passaging to the circular orbit.     On the problem of calculating shear deformations in prismatic bars made of polymer materials under tension with torsion

    Get PDF
    The process of creep of prismatic rods made of linear-viscoelastic polymeric materials under combined loading is considered. Defining equations that determine the relationship between strains, stresses and time are given in the form of a superposition of shear and bulk strain. The object of study is prismatic bars made of fiberglass ST-1. The area of linearity of the model is substantiated on the basis of the hypothesis of the existence of the creep function, which is built on the yield curves, a single diagram of long-term deformation and the statistical value of the quantile of statistics. The region of linear-elastic deformation is recognized based on the fulfillment of the condition of existence of a single creep function. The defining equations of the model contain a set of functions and coefficients determined from the basic experiments. On the basis of the relations between the kernels of the one-dimensional stress state, the parameters of the kernels under the condition of a complex stress state are determined. The linearity of viscoelastic properties is given by the Boltzmann-Voltaire equations. The fractional-exponential kernels of heredity are chosen as the kernels of heredity. The obtained values of the core parameters are used to calculate the creep deformations of prismatic bars made of ST-1 fiberglass under conditions of simultaneous tensile tension.     Numerical simulation of the thermo-stress-strain state of elements under 3D printing

    Get PDF
    The paper is devoted to the assessment of the thermo-stress-strain state of elements of structures obtained by 3D printing using FDM (Fusing Deposition Modeling) technology. Three stages of solving this problem are considered: (1) - mathematical formulation of the problem, that includes universal balance relations, constitutive equations of mechanical behavior of the material and is based on the model of growing bodies; (2) the technique of finite-element solution with increasing mesh due to the addition of new elements; (3) - study of a specific problem of growing plate-like element by polymer PLA (polylactide) with temperature-dependent physical properties. Options of deposed layers of different thickness are considered. The residual stress-strain state of the body has a two-scale structure, which reflects the change of state characteristics in the scale of body size, as well as the thickness of the layers. As the thickness of the layers increases, the average values of the residual stresses decrease, but the amplitude of the stress fluctuations along the thickness of the layer slightly increase.     Stochastic models in artificial intelligence development

    Get PDF
    In this paper, we consider some properties of stochastic random matrices of large dimensions under conditions of independence of matrix elements or under conditions of independence of rows (columns). The main properties of stochastic random matrices spectrum are analyzed and the result of convergence to 0 is proved of almost all eigenvalues. Also, the application of these results to clustering problems and selection of the optimal number of clusters is considered. Note that the results obtained in this work are consistent with the Marchenko - Pastur theorem on the asymptotic distribution of eigenvalues of random matrices with independent elements. The results proved in this paper can be interpreted as a law of large numbers and will be used in the study of the asymptotic behavior of the maximum.     Monte-Carlo method for option pricing in sub-diffusive arithmetic models

    No full text
    This paper focuses on applying the Monte Carlo approach to option pricing in markets with illiquid assets. Anomalous sub-diffusion is a well-known model for describing such markets when relatively long periods without any trading are observed. For constructing sub-diffusive models we need to replace a calendar time t with some stochastic processes S(t), which is called inverse subordinator. The inverse subordinator S(t) means first hitting time and is based on subordinator processes. In this paper, we propose to use the gamma process as a subordinator for Bashelie sub-diffusion model. Using well-known properties for gamma and inverse gamma processes we find the covariance structure of fractional Bachelier model with FBM time-changed by gamma process and then explore the asymptotic behavior of it. Then we apply the Monte-Carlo method and propose a procedure of option pricing for the Bashelie sub-diffusion model. For this aim, we use iterative schemes for simulating N scenarios of stock prices for our models. Finally, we demonstrate numerical results.     Optimization of power distribution of network channels based on Orlin\u27s algorithm

    Get PDF
    The article proposes an algorithm for solving the problem of optimal distribution of the capacity of data transmission channels between providers and Internet users. A mathematical model of the problem of distribution of a limited homogeneous resource with transport-type constraints is formulated. A solution method based on Orlin\u27s stream algorithm is considered. A practical application of the algorithm for solving a real distribution problem is proposed. The results of the capacity of the channels of the computer network are obtained with a perspective increase in the capacity of the connections represented by the intervals of the planned changes. An analysis of the solutions obtained with different number of switching servers was made, conclusions about the choice of the provider to meet the optimal information needs of users were made.
